In 2019-2020, 997 people earned their degree in landscape architecture, making the major the 392nd most popular in the United States.
Across North Carolina, there were 24 landscape architecture gra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 15 landscape architecture graduates with average earnings and debt of $55,088 and $45,388 respectively.

Top 1 Best Value Master’s Degree Colleges for Landscape Architecture (Income $75-$110k) in North Carolina
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end North Carolina State University.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Landscape Architecture Schools for a Master’s in North Carolina For Those Making $75-$110k. NC State is a large public school situated in Raleigh, North Carolina. It awarded 15 masters’s landscape architecture degrees in 2019-2020.
NC State also made our “Best Landscape Architecture Master’s Degree Schools in North Carolina” list, coming in at #1. Average graduate tuition and fees at North Carolina State University are $28,999,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
